For the 2026 school year, there is 1 public school serving 395 students in the neighborhood of North Carolina Central University, Durham, NC.
The neighborhood of North Carolina Central University, Durham, NC public school have an average math proficiency score of 95% (versus the North Carolina public school average of 51%).
Minority enrollment is 95% of the student body (majority Black), which is more than the North Carolina public school average of 57% (majority Black and Hispanic).
